Kiwanis Park 2025 Improvements

Kiwanis Park 2025 Improvements

 

As previously stated, the existing tennis courts are in poor condition and cannot be replaced in the current location due to provincially regulated archaeological considerations in the area. Additionally, the current location does not meet today's requirements for proper spacing from private property lines. As a result, the existing tennis courts will be removed and restored with native plant material.

In the summer of 2024, the community was invited to provide feedback on what sports court should be constructed east of the existing washroom building. The City received very positive feedback and would like to thank all who completed the online survey.

Based on public input, the following will be constructed east of the existing washroom building, subject to archaeology and regulatory approvals:

- Two pickleball courts

- One-half basketball court

- Seating Area

- Tree planting 

In addition to the work above, future improvements will be made to the existing spray pad and washroom building.
